As part of the 16th International Conference on Computational Science and Its Applications (ICCSA 2016) that will take place in Beijing, China on July 4-7, 2016, LIST will co-organise the workshop "Computational Algorithms for Sustainability Assessment" (CLASS 2016).
This workshop aims at presenting methods and applications rooted in different scientific domains, which are envisioned to provide a valid contribution to the modern developments in the assessment of the environmental impacts linked to human activities. A distinguishing feature of the workshop is its interdisciplinary nature. It aims at advancing on the path towards an integrated operational framework for Quantitative Sustainability Assessment, enhancing cooperation of scientists belonging to different disciplines under the overarching umbrella of a lifecycle based perspective.
The proceedings of the workshop will be published in the Springer collection Lecture Notes on Computer Science (LNCS).
